The Essential Role of Sodium in the Body
Before we delve into the potential downsides of excessive salt consumption, it’s vital to acknowledge its indispensable role. Sodium, the primary electrolyte in our extracellular fluid, is not merely a flavour enhancer; it’s a critical component for numerous bodily functions.
Fluid Balance and Blood Volume
One of sodium’s most important functions is its role in maintaining fluid balance. It attracts water, helping to regulate the amount of fluid inside and outside our cells. This, in turn, directly influences our blood volume. Adequate blood volume is essential for delivering oxygen and nutrients to all tissues and organs, and for removing waste products. Sodium helps maintain the osmotic pressure that keeps fluids in the bloodstream, preventing dehydration and ensuring proper circulation.
Nerve Impulse Transmission
Our nervous system relies on the movement of electrolytes, including sodium, to transmit electrical signals. When a nerve cell is stimulated, sodium ions rush into the cell, creating an electrical impulse. This process, known as depolarization, is fundamental for everything from muscle contractions to thought processes. Without sufficient sodium, nerve communication would be severely impaired.
Muscle Contraction
Similar to nerve function, muscle contraction also depends on the movement of sodium ions. The electrical signal that triggers a muscle to contract involves the influx of sodium into muscle cells. This electrical event initiates a cascade of chemical reactions that result in the shortening of muscle fibres, allowing us to move.
The Dark Side of Excessive Sodium Intake
While essential in moderation, the modern Western diet often leads to a significant overconsumption of sodium, far exceeding the body’s physiological needs. This excess can trigger a cascade of negative health consequences, primarily by disrupting the delicate balance our bodies strive to maintain.
High Blood Pressure: The Silent Threat
Perhaps the most well-documented and significant consequence of excessive salt intake is its contribution to high blood pressure, also known as hypertension. When you consume too much sodium, your body retains more water to dilute the excess salt in your bloodstream. This increased fluid volume puts extra pressure on your blood vessel walls, leading to elevated blood pressure. Over time, this sustained high pressure can damage your arteries, making them less elastic and more prone to blockages.
The Mechanism Behind Hypertension
The kidneys play a crucial role in regulating blood pressure by filtering waste and excess fluid. However, when presented with an overload of sodium, the kidneys struggle to excrete it efficiently. To maintain a stable concentration of sodium in the blood, the body holds onto more water. This extra fluid increases the total volume of blood circulating through your vascular system. Imagine a garden hose: if you increase the amount of water flowing through it while keeping the hose the same diameter, the pressure inside the hose will rise. Similarly, increased blood volume increases the pressure against the artery walls.
Long-Term Cardiovascular Risks
Chronically elevated blood pressure is a major risk factor for serious cardiovascular diseases. It significantly increases your risk of:
- Heart Attack: High blood pressure can damage the arteries supplying the heart, making them more susceptible to blockages by plaque.
- Stroke: Similarly, it can damage the blood vessels in the brain, increasing the likelihood of a blood clot forming or a blood vessel rupting.
- Heart Failure: Over time, the heart has to work harder to pump blood against increased resistance caused by high blood pressure. This can lead to the heart muscle thickening and eventually weakening, resulting in heart failure.
- Kidney Disease: The delicate blood vessels in the kidneys can be damaged by high blood pressure, impairing their ability to filter waste and fluid, potentially leading to kidney failure.
The Sodium-Water Connection: Beyond Blood Pressure
The relationship between sodium and water retention extends beyond just blood pressure. Excess sodium can also lead to fluid accumulation in other parts of the body, manifesting as:
- Edema (Swelling): This is particularly noticeable in the extremities, such as the ankles, feet, and hands. The body’s attempt to dilute high sodium levels can lead to fluid seeping out of blood vessels into surrounding tissues.
- Bloating: Many people report feeling bloated and experiencing discomfort when their sodium intake is high. This is due to water retention in the abdominal area.
Impact on Kidney Health
The kidneys are on the front lines of managing sodium balance. When sodium intake is consistently high, the kidneys have to work harder to filter and excrete the excess. This increased workload, coupled with the elevated blood pressure that often accompanies high sodium intake, can contribute to kidney damage over time. The tiny blood vessels within the kidneys can become narrowed or scarred, impairing their filtering capacity.
Osteoporosis and Calcium Excretion
While the link is less direct than with blood pressure, some research suggests that high sodium intake may negatively impact bone health. The body attempts to maintain a healthy sodium balance by excreting excess sodium through urine. However, this process can also lead to increased calcium excretion. Over prolonged periods, this loss of calcium, a vital component of bone structure, could potentially contribute to weakened bones and an increased risk of osteoporosis.
Increased Thirst and Dehydration Risk
Paradoxically, while high sodium intake causes water retention, it can also trigger increased thirst. This is the body’s signal to try and rehydrate and dilute the concentrated sodium in the bloodstream. If this thirst isn’t adequately quenched, or if fluid intake is insufficient, chronic dehydration can occur.
Where is All This Sodium Hiding?
Understanding the health implications of salt is one thing; identifying its sources is another. While we might reach for the salt shaker at the dinner table, the vast majority of sodium in the modern diet comes from processed and restaurant foods.
Processed Foods: The Sodium Culprits
The food industry often uses salt not only for flavour but also as a preservative and to enhance texture and shelf-life. Consequently, many common processed foods are laden with sodium, even those that don’t taste particularly salty.
- Canned Goods: Soups, vegetables, and meats often contain significant amounts of added salt for preservation.
- Deli Meats and Processed Meats: Bacon, sausages, ham, and cold cuts are typically high in sodium.
- Snack Foods: Chips, pretzels, crackers, and salted nuts are obvious sources, but even seemingly healthy snacks can surprise you.
- Frozen Meals and Packaged Dinners: These convenient options are often a sodium minefield.
- Condiments and Sauces: Ketchup, soy sauce, salad dressings, and marinades can be surprisingly high in sodium.
- Bread and Baked Goods: Many types of bread, rolls, and pastries contain added salt.
Restaurant Meals: A Hidden Sodium Trap
Eating out can also be a significant source of hidden sodium. Restaurant chefs often use salt liberally to enhance flavour, and many dishes are prepared with pre-made sauces and ingredients that are already high in sodium.
Finding a Healthy Balance: Reducing Your Sodium Intake
The good news is that managing your sodium intake is achievable and can significantly improve your health. The key lies in making informed choices and being mindful of what you consume.
Reading Food Labels: Your First Line of Defence
Becoming a diligent reader of food labels is one of the most powerful tools you have. Look for the “Nutrition Facts” panel and pay close attention to the sodium content.
- Daily Value (%DV): The %DV for sodium indicates how much of a nutrient is in a serving of food. A food that provides 5% DV or less of sodium per serving is considered low, while 20% DV or more is considered high.
- Sodium per Serving: Be mindful of the serving size. If you eat more than one serving, you’ll consume more sodium.
- “Low Sodium,” “Reduced Sodium,” and “No Salt Added”: Familiarize yourself with these terms. “Low sodium” means 140 milligrams or less per serving. “Reduced sodium” means at least 25% less sodium than the regular product. “No salt added” means no salt was added during processing, but the food may still contain naturally occurring sodium.
Making Smart Swaps and Cooking at Home
Empowering yourself by cooking more meals at home allows you complete control over the ingredients, including the amount of salt.
- Prioritize Fresh, Whole Foods: Fruits, vegetables, lean proteins, and whole grains are naturally lower in sodium.
- Experiment with Herbs and Spices: Instead of reaching for the salt shaker, explore the vast world of herbs, spices, garlic, onion, lemon juice, and vinegars to add flavour to your dishes.
- Choose Lower-Sodium Versions: Opt for low-sodium canned goods, broths, and condiments whenever possible.
- Rinse Canned Foods: Rinsing canned vegetables and beans can help remove some of the surface salt.
- Be Wary of Salty Triggers: If you know certain processed foods are high in sodium, try to limit them or find healthier alternatives.

How much sodium is too much for the average adult?
The recommended daily sodium intake for most adults is generally considered to be no more than 2,300 milligrams, which is equivalent to about one teaspoon of salt. However, for individuals with certain health conditions, such as high blood pressure, the recommended limit may be even lower, around 1,500 milligrams per day. These guidelines are established by health organizations to help reduce the risk of cardiovascular diseases and other health complications associated with excessive sodium consumption.
It’s important to be aware that much of the sodium we consume comes from processed and restaurant foods, rather than from the salt shaker at home. Reading food labels and making conscious choices to select lower-sodium options can significantly contribute to staying within healthy limits. Being mindful of hidden sodium in seemingly unsalted items is a key strategy in managing overall intake.
What are the primary health risks associated with consuming too much sodium?
The most well-known health risk of excessive sodium intake is its significant contribution to high blood pressure, also known as hypertension. Sodium causes the body to retain water, which increases the volume of blood in your bloodstream. This extra fluid puts more pressure on your blood vessel walls, leading to elevated blood pressure over time.
Over the long term, persistently high blood pressure can damage blood vessels and vital organs, increasing the risk of serious health problems such as heart disease, stroke, kidney disease, and even vision loss. Furthermore, some research suggests that high sodium intake can also be linked to an increased risk of stomach cancer and osteoporosis.
Can sodium impact kidney function?
Yes, excessive sodium consumption can negatively impact kidney function. The kidneys are responsible for filtering waste and excess fluid from the blood, including sodium. When you consume too much sodium, your kidneys have to work harder to excrete the excess, which can put a strain on these organs over time.
This increased workload can contribute to the development or worsening of kidney disease, particularly in individuals who already have pre-existing kidney conditions or other risk factors like diabetes and high blood pressure. By reducing sodium intake, you can help alleviate this burden on your kidneys and support their overall health.
Does sodium affect fluid balance in the body?
Absolutely. Sodium plays a crucial role in regulating the fluid balance within and around your body’s cells. It is a key electrolyte that helps maintain the proper distribution of water between the inside and outside of cells, as well as in the bloodstream.
When you consume too much sodium, your body tries to dilute it by retaining more water. This increased fluid volume in your blood vessels directly contributes to higher blood pressure. Conversely, if sodium levels are too low, it can lead to dehydration and electrolyte imbalances.
What are some common sources of hidden sodium in the diet?
Many foods that don’t taste overtly salty can be surprisingly high in sodium. Processed and pre-packaged foods are major culprits, including canned soups and vegetables, processed meats like deli meats and sausages, frozen dinners, and salty snacks like chips and pretzels. Bread and baked goods can also contribute a significant amount of sodium.
Restaurant meals, fast food, and prepared sauces, marinades, and salad dressings are other common sources of hidden sodium. These items are often loaded with sodium for flavor and preservation purposes. Reading nutrition labels carefully and opting for fresh, whole foods whenever possible are excellent strategies to avoid these hidden sodium traps.
Are there benefits to consuming sodium in moderation?
Yes, sodium is an essential nutrient that the body needs to function properly. In moderation, it plays a vital role in maintaining fluid balance, nerve impulse transmission, and muscle contractions. Our bodies require a certain amount of sodium to keep our blood pressure within a healthy range and to ensure that our cells have the correct fluid concentration.
When sodium is consumed in appropriate amounts, it supports critical physiological processes. The key is to consume it within recommended daily limits, as the body naturally regulates its sodium levels. Focusing on whole, unprocessed foods often provides sufficient sodium without the need for added salt.
What are strategies for reducing sodium intake in my daily diet?
A primary strategy for reducing sodium intake is to focus on eating more fresh, whole foods and limiting processed and pre-packaged items. Cooking meals at home from scratch allows you to control the amount of salt added. When purchasing packaged foods, actively seek out those labeled as “low sodium,” “reduced sodium,” or “no salt added.”
Additionally, be mindful of condiments, sauces, and marinades, which can be high in sodium. Opt for low-sodium versions or explore homemade alternatives. Reading nutrition labels and comparing the sodium content of different products is crucial. Gradually reducing your sodium intake can also help your taste buds adjust, making lower-sodium foods more enjoyable over time.
